Singapore National Eye Centre (SNEC) has implemented Appointment System Optimiser (ASO) to enhance the scheduling of your follow-up appointments. The implementation of ASO aims to provide a better patient experience. With the implementation of ASO, when will I be notified of my appointment details? If your next appointment is in 2 months or lessYour appointment details will be sent via SMS to your locally registered mobile number within 3 working days If your next appointment(s) is more than 2 months later Your appointment details will be sent via SMS to your locally registered mobile number about 6 weeks before your next appointment. For Patients with No Locally Registered Phone Number Please approach our counter staff at the clinics.
